Volex offers tethered and untethered EV charging cables for installation on charging infrastructure or in-vehicle charging cable applications.
Volex charging cables are suitable for the AC (alternating current) charging of electric vehicles. These cables are available in tethered and untethered versions, in single and three phase AC current, with charging powers of up to 80A. They are available with NACS, Type 1 and Type 2 connectors in accordance with global standards. In addition to cables for installation on charging infrastructure, there are also electric car charging cables that can be stored in the vehicle.
Complete product range for NACS, Type 1, Type 2, and GB/T
Functional, compact housing for best handling
Customized designs available including cosmetic appearance and branding requirements for charging station or home charger
Compatible for both indoor and outdoor use, with UV compliance
Regulatory and safety approvals
Compliant with NACS, SAE J1772/IEC62196 Type I, IEC62196 Type II, and GB/T 20234 standards
Ingress protection minimum rating: IP67
Encapsulation to protect against thermal, drive over and drop test requirements
